eBay
& The Importance of Great Customer Service
If you are running an eBay business or plan
on doing so, you may not realize that great customer service
is very important. When a buyer
receives good quality customer service from you, they will
most likely do one of two things, or even both. They will
give you good positive feedback, and they may even look for
more of your auctions in the future. If you hope to make
money selling on ebay, or even make a living from eBay,
you should stop thinking of it as an auction, and start thinking
of it as an actual business.
If you owned another type of business, how would you treat
your customer while they were standing at your counter, waiting
for you to finish ringing up their order? You would be as
helpful and as respectful as you can! You would do everything
that you could do to guarantee that the customer returns to
your establishment in the future. You would bend over backwards
to make sure that their buying experience with you was both
satisfactory and enjoyable. So then why would you do anything
less of that at the close of one of your eBay auctions?
You want to act quickly at the end of your auctions. Contact
the winner, and congratulate them as soon as possible. You
should describe the item they have won and how the item will
be shipped, even if that information is already part of the
description for the auction. Then remind them of their winning
bid amount, and give them payment options & instructions.
Be sure to let them know when the item will be shipped.
When you close your email, thank them for participating in
your auction. You might even take this opportunity to tell
them about other open auctions that you have as well that
they might be interested in.
Once the payment and shipping details have been taken care
of, contact your buyer again and let them know when the item
was shipped. Tell them the exact date and time, and when it
is expected to arrive on their end. During this contact, let
them know that if they have any questions or problems, that
they should contact you through the eBay site. If they do
contact you in the future, make sure that you answer them
quickly, and that you do all that you can to make them happy
with their purchase, even if it means issuing them a refund.
Yes - You should definately be open to issuing refunds. Furthermore,
you should issue refunds promptly. Of course, it is reasonable
to expect the buyer to return the item to you at your expense,
before the refund is issued. But once you receive the item,
issue the refund promptly. This is just good business that
you will want to maintain!
